EASY WHOLE WHEAT PEANUT BUTTER COOKIES
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
- In a large bowl, mix together the peanut butter, butter, honey, brown sugar and egg until smooth. Combine the whole wheat flour and baking powder; stir into the batter until blended. Roll into small balls, and place on a greased cookie sheet. Flatten slightly using a fork.
- Bake for 13 to 15 minutes in the preheated oven, or until cookies are slightly toasted at the edges.

PEANUT BUTTER WAFFLES
Found in my TOH Simple & Delicious magazine and fell in love immediately. I served with warmed mixed jelly - that way it was more syrupy than jellied. It is great with just some butter spread on it and fresh fruit too. Hope you like them too. I have put the serving as 2 waffles so this creates 5 servings (10 waffles total)
Provided by HokiesMom
Categories Breakfast
Time 25m
Yield 10 waffles, 5 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- In a large bowl, combine the flour, sugar, baking powder, baking soda and cinnamon.
- In another bowl, separate egg yolks into bowl (keep egg whites in another small bowl). Whisk egg yolks, milk, peanut butter and butter.
- Stir egg yolk mixture into dry ingredients just until moistened.
- In the small bowl with the egg whites, beat the egg whites until stiff peaks form. Fold the egg whites into the batter.
- Bake waffles in a preheated waffle iron that has been sprayed lightly with cooking spray. Use the temperature setting to get the end results you prefer in your waffles - we like ours just golden brown but hubby likes his a bit more cooked so it is crispier.
- Serve with heated jelly (so it is more like a syrup), or use a fruit flavored syrup, or just serve with fresh fruit and yogurt.

ELVIS-INSPIRED PEANUT BUTTER BANANA WAFFLES
Elvis famously loved peanut butter and banana sandwiches, often with bacon. It was that delicious combo that led to these family-friendly waffles. I think the King would approve!
Provided by Audrey Johns
Categories HarperCollins Waffle Breakfast Peanut Butter Banana Brunch Kid-Friendly Vegetarian Kidney Friendly Pescatarian Soy Free Kosher Small Plates
Yield Makes 10 waffles
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- Preheat a waffle maker. Preheat the oven to 200˚F
- In a medium bowl, use the back of a fork to smash the bananas with the peanut butter. Add the eggs, vanilla, and almond milk and whisk to combine. Set aside.
- In a large bowl, combine the flour, brown sugar, baking soda, and salt. Fold the wet mixture into the dry mixture and mix until just combined.
- Spray the waffle maker with olive oil spray. Spoon 1/3 cup batter into the waffle maker and cook until lightly browned, according to the manufacturer's instructions. As the waffles are done, transfer them to a baking sheet and place the sheet in the oven to keep warm. Repeat to make the rest of the waffles, spraying the waffle maker with olive oil spray before adding the batter each time.
- If you like a crispy waffle, pop it in the toaster for a minute before serving and it will crisp up to perfection.

CHEWY WHOLE WHEAT PEANUT BUTTER BROWNIES
These are a great take on the Peanut Butter Brownie. You can't tell the difference between whole wheat and regular flour. My family eats them up EVERY TIME I bake them.
Provided by DMOMMY
Categories Desserts Cookies Brownie Recipes Blondie Recipes
Time 55m
Yield 16
Number Of Ingredients 12
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ees Celsius). Grease a 9x9 inch baking pan.
- In a large mixing bowl, beat together margarine and sugars; add eggs one at a time, and beat until mixture is light and fluffy. Stir in peanut butter, vanilla, and water.
- In a separate mixing bowl, mix together flours with salt, baking powder, and baking soda. Stir into peanut butter mixture and blend well. Spread batter into the prepared pan.
- Bake in preheated oven for 30 to 35 minutes, or until the top springs back when touched. Cool and cut into 16 squares.

WHOLE WHEAT-OAT WAFFLES
Mix the batter with a fork until it just barely comes together. A lumpy batter now means a light and tender waffle later.
Provided by Deb Perelman
Categories Bon Appétit Breakfast Brunch Waffle Whole Wheat Oat Blueberry Butter Lemon Vegetarian Soy Free Peanut Free Tree Nut Free Kid-Friendly
Yield 4-6 servings
Number Of Ingredients 15
Steps:
- Syrup:
- Bring lemon zest, sugar, and ⅔ cup water to a boil in a heavy medium saucepan, stirring until sugar dissolves. Cook (do not stir) until a thin syrup forms, 6-8 minutes. Add blueberries and bring to a simmer. Reduce heat to medium; cook, stirring constantly, 2 minutes.
- Transfer 2 Tbsp. syrup to a small bowl, add cornstarch, and stir until smooth. Add back to syrup; simmer until thickened, about 1 minute. Remove from heat. Fish out lemon zest and discard. Squeeze in lemon juice to taste and let cool slightly.
- Waffles and assembly:
- Whisk flour, oats, baking powder, baking soda, and salt in a large bowl. Make a well in the center and add yogurt, then melted butter, then egg to well. Using a fork, stir together wet ingredients, then mix, incorporating dry ingredients a little at a time, until a lumpy batter forms.
- Heat waffle iron on medium-low. Lightly coat with nonstick spray and pour a heaping ½ cup batter onto iron (or up to 2 cups if using a larger one). Cook until waffles are golden brown and cooked through, about 5 minutes. (Keep warm on a baking sheet in a 300° oven if desired.) Repeat with remaining batter, coating iron with more nonstick spray as needed. Serve with butter and warm syrup.
